Вопросы по теме 'wolfram-mathematica'

Вызов программы Mathematica из командной строки с аргументами командной строки, stdin, stdout и stderr.
Если у вас есть код Mathematica в foo.m, Mathematica может быть вызвана с помощью -noprompt и с -initfile foo.m (или -run "<<foo.m" ), а аргументы командной строки доступны в $CommandLine (с дополнительным мусором там), но есть ли способ...
12411 просмотров

Почему это не сработает? Динамический в выборе
Ок, делаю так: Select[Range[1, 20], # > Dynamic[q] &] И затем я создаю слайдер: Slider[Dynamic[q], {1, 20}] И он всегда будет возвращать пустой набор! Почему! Обновить Целью этого является изменение набора при...
2080 просмотров
schedule 24.01.2023

Сложные вычисления в C#
Какие инструменты (наиболее эффективные) доступны в .NET (C#) для расчета: интегралы частные производные другая нетривиальная математика Люди, пожалуйста, прокомментируйте Mathematica и Matlab и их интеграцию в C# ?
4634 просмотров
schedule 10.04.2023

Отфильтровать подсписок в Mathematica
Я новичок в математике. Вот моя проблема: Например, у меня есть вложенный список: lst = {{1, 0, 0}, {0, 1, 1}, {2, 0, 1}, {1}, {0,3}} Я хочу вывести только те подсписки, элементы которых равны 0 или 1. Вывод приведенного выше списка...
1135 просмотров
schedule 09.07.2023

Как мне максимизировать функцию в Mathematica, которая принимает список переменной длины в качестве входных данных?
У меня есть функция, похожая на временной ряд, которая дает результат на основе списка реальных чисел (т.е. вы можете запустить функцию в списке 1,2,3,... реальных чисел). Проблема, с которой я сталкиваюсь, заключается в том, как максимизировать...
1875 просмотров
schedule 14.08.2022

Выразите число словами в Mathematica
Я слышал, что мы можем использовать английские слова, чтобы выразить число в Mathematica. Например, используя Сто , чтобы выразить 100. Какая функция может это сделать?
1682 просмотров
schedule 15.06.2023

Смешанные масштабные и обычные координаты в Mathematica?
Можно ли указать положение с точки зрения масштабированных координат в одном направлении и использовать обычные координаты из моих точек данных в другом направлении на графике? Другими словами, я хочу указать позицию, где координата x является...
284 просмотров
schedule 31.03.2023

Парсер для синтаксиса Mathematica?
Есть ли встроенный синтаксический анализатор, который я могу использовать из С#, который может анализировать математические выражения? Я знаю, что могу использовать само ядро ​​для анализа выражения и использовать .NET/Link для извлечения...
2213 просмотров
schedule 16.06.2023

Необязательные именованные аргументы в Mathematica
Какой лучший/канонический способ определить функцию с необязательными именованными аргументами? Для конкретики создадим функцию foo с именованными аргументами a , b и c , которые по умолчанию равны 1, 2 и 3 соответственно. Для сравнения, вот...
3124 просмотров

Поиск ранее определенных сообщений в системе Mathematica
Mathematica по умолчанию определяет множество полезных сообщений для оповещения о распространенных ошибках, таких как вызов функций с неверным количеством аргументов или отсутствие файлов. В общем, я предпочитаю использовать существующие,...
192 просмотров
schedule 01.01.2024

Начало работы с пакетами Mathematica
Может кто-нибудь дать совет о том, как начать работу с пакетами математики? Я могу сохранить следующее в файле с именем «Foo.m». Когда я запускаю ячейку ввода в этом файле, я вижу эффекты, отраженные в переменной $ ContextPath....
638 просмотров

Целевое упрощение в Mathematica
Я генерирую очень длинные и сложные аналитические выражения общего вида: (...something not so complex...)(...ditto...)(...ditto...)...lots... Когда я пытаюсь использовать Simplify , Mathematica останавливается, как я предполагаю, из-за...
2008 просмотров
schedule 20.05.2023

Mathematica, кривые PDF и затенение
Мне нужно построить нормальное распределение, а затем заштриховать его конкретную область. Прямо сейчас я делаю это, создавая график распределения и накладывая его на RegionPlot. Это довольно запутанно, и я уверен, что должен быть более элегантный...
1301 просмотров
schedule 19.09.2022

Решение векторных уравнений в Mathematica
Я пытаюсь понять, как использовать Mathematica для решения систем уравнений, где некоторые переменные и коэффициенты являются векторами. Простым примером может быть что-то вроде где я знаю A , V и величину P , и мне нужно найти t и...
14586 просмотров
schedule 27.09.2022

Вызов Java-проекта из Mathematica
Не могли бы вы дать мне подсказку, как я могу вызвать проект Java (написанный в eclipse) из Mathematica? Я хочу передать значения, сгенерированные моей программой Mathematica, в качестве входных данных для java-проекта и использовать (выходные)...
981 просмотров
schedule 09.08.2022

Есть ли в Mathematica функция, эквивалентная уникальной функции Matlab?
Существует ли функция Mathematica, которая дает результаты, эквивалентные функции unique() в MATLAB? Я понимаю, что мог бы использовать функцию Union[] для получения уникальных элементов списка, но я хотел бы что-то эквивалентное версии функции с...
2828 просмотров
schedule 06.05.2022

Ошибка в Mathematica: регулярное выражение применялось к очень длинной строке
В следующем коде, если к строке s добавляется что-то вроде 10 или 20 тысяч символов, происходит сбой сегментации ядра Mathematica. s = "This is the first line. MAGIC_STRING Everything after this line should get removed....
836 просмотров
schedule 06.05.2023

2D-интегралы в SciPy
Я пытаюсь интегрировать функцию с несколькими переменными в SciPy в двухмерной области. Что будет эквивалентно следующему коду Mathematica ? In[1]:= F[x_, y_] := Cos[x] + Cos[y] In[2]:= Integrate[F[x, y], {x, -\[Pi], \[Pi]}, {y, -\[Pi],...
9219 просмотров

Как работать с большими файлами данных в Wolfram Mathematica
Интересно, существует ли способ работы с большими файлами в Mathematica? В настоящее время у меня есть файл размером около 500 МБ с данными таблицы. Import["data.txt","Table"]; Что такое альтернативный путь?
7719 просмотров
schedule 02.11.2022

Регулярные выражения Mathematica для строк Unicode
Это был увлекательный опыт отладки. Можете ли вы найти разницу между следующими двумя строками? StringReplace["–", RegularExpression@"[\\s\\S]" -> "abc"] StringReplace["-", RegularExpression@"[\\s\\S]" -> "abc"] Они делают очень разные...
390 просмотров